Orthopaedics, Welbeck London is a fully integrated musculoskeletal centre in London's Harley Street district, bringing orthopaedic surgeons, sports medicine physicians, rheumatologists, pain consultants, podiatric surgeons, and hand therapists together under one roof. Sub-specialty teams cover shoulder, hand and wrist, hip and knee, spine and sports injuries, delivering seamless care for athletes and non-athletes alike.What medical services does it specialise in? The centre brings together specialists in Orthopaedic Surgery (bone, joint, and musculoskeletal care), Paediatric Orthopaedics, Rheumatology, Pain Medicine, Neurology, Plastic Surgery, Podiatry and Radiology (medical imaging and diagnostic studies).What tests and treatments does it offer? For over 50 years, The Wellington Hospital has delivered outstanding private healthcare in St John's Wood. With more than 1,000 specialist consultants, 30 intensive care beds and a JAG-accredited endoscopy centre, it offers comprehensive care in cardiology, oncology, neurology, neurosurgery, orthopaedics, gastroenterology and gynaecology — within a campus of specialist facilities. What medical services does it specialise in? The Wellington Hospital brings together leading specialists across cardiology, medical oncology (cancer care), gastroenterology (digestive health, with a JAG-accredited endoscopy centre), orthopaedic surgery, neurology, neurosurgery, general surgery and obstetrics and gynaecology, with over 1,000 consultants across specialist multidisciplinary teams. The Priory Hospital, part of Circle Health Group, is the largest private hospital in Birmingham, West Midlands and focuses on providing patients with the utmost care and consultant-led treatment tailored around them. The Priory Hospital's Outpatient department provides the perfect space to meet specialist consultants and discuss any concerns that patients may have. They have a comprehensive imaging department for fast access to diagnosis and treatment. The Priory Hospital has an interventional suite for cardiac and radiology procedures; a dedicated cancer centre supporting patients at every step of their journey; a specialist fertility centre that offers a full range of conception therapies to help patients achieve their dream of becoming parents; a critical care unit, giving patients and consultants the peace of mind that a higher level of support is available. They perform a wide variety of procedures in the fields of orthopaedic surgery, general surgery, gynaecology and urology, but do also offer more complex procedures such as cardiac, thoracic and cancer surgery.
